Bradypacing: indications and management challenges in Nigeria
M O Thomas1, D A Oke, E O Ogunleye
1Lagos University Teaching Hospital/College of Medicine of University of Lagos, Lagos, Nigeria. oluwafemithomas@yahoo.com
Most Nigerian bradyarrhythmia patients can be effectively treated with single lead ventricular pacing, a cost-effective option. This study highlights the common indications and demographic profile for permanent pacemaker implantation in Nigeria.

Background:
- Permanent pacemaker implantation is a critical intervention globally.
- There is limited published data on pacemaker surgery outcomes in Nigeria.
- Understanding local trends is crucial for healthcare planning.
Purpose of the Study:
- To investigate indications for pacemaker insertion in Nigeria.
- To analyze demographic characteristics of patients receiving pacemakers.
- To identify electrocardiographic (ECG) changes and management challenges.
Main Methods:
- A retrospective review of 100 consecutive pacemaker implantations.
- Data collected included patient biodata, indications, ECG findings, and treatment.
- Study period commenced in 1999.
Main Results:
- Female patients constituted the majority (93.0%).
- Third-degree heart block was the predominant indication (86.0%).
- Single lead ventricular pacing proved effective and economical.
Conclusions:
- Single lead ventricular pacing is a viable and sufficient option for most bradyarrhythmia patients in this region.
- This approach offers a cost-effective solution for pacemaker management.
